A primitive campground, located in a Pinyon Pine and Juniper forest at 8,200′ elevation. Great views down into Death Valley. Located near the Telescope Peak trailhead. Dirt road access requires high-clearance vehicles, often 4×4 required.Mahogany Flat Campground directions and information are available at https://www.nps.gov/deva/planyourvisit/mahogany-flat-primitive-campground.htm.(760) 786-3202deva_information@nps.govdeva_information@nps.gov
